A specialized base affixed to a Marlin 336 lever-action rifle, enabling simultaneous use of a riflescope and the firearm’s iron sights. This type of mount positions the scope higher above the barrel than a traditional scope mount, allowing the user to see through the mount and utilize the original iron sights for close-range shots or as a backup sighting system. An example would be a cantilever-style mount with a raised profile designed specifically for this purpose.

This accessory offers significant advantages for hunters and sport shooters. The ability to quickly transition between magnified optics and iron sights provides versatility in diverse shooting scenarios. While a scope excels in medium to long-range engagements, iron sights often offer faster target acquisition at closer distances. This dual sighting system is particularly valuable in fast-paced hunting situations where targets may appear suddenly at varying ranges. Historically, these mounts have gained popularity due to their practicality and adaptability, enhancing the overall utility of the Marlin 336 platform.

1. Height

Mount height is arguably the most critical factor when choosing a see-through scope mount for a Marlin 336. The primary purpose of this type of mount is to allow simultaneous use of a scope and iron sights. A mount that sits too low obstructs the sight line, rendering the iron sights unusable and defeating the purpose of the see-through design. Conversely, a mount that is too high can create an uncomfortable cheek weld and negatively impact shooting posture, leading to reduced accuracy and shooter fatigue. For example, a mount designed for an AR-15 platform, even if adaptable to a Marlin 336, will likely position the scope too high for effective use of the iron sights.

The optimal height allows a clear view through the mount to the iron sights while maintaining a comfortable cheek weld and proper eye alignment with the scope. This balance is crucial for quick target acquisition in varied hunting or shooting scenarios. Manufacturers often specify a “see-through” height in their product descriptions. However, individual preferences and the specific rifle configuration (buttstock style, comb height) can influence the ideal height. Therefore, careful consideration and potentially some experimentation may be required to achieve the optimal setup. For instance, users with higher cheekbones might require a taller mount than those with lower cheekbones to maintain a comfortable cheek weld.

Proper mount height ensures the see-through functionality delivers its intended benefit rapid transitioning between magnified optics and iron sights. Selecting the correct height minimizes compromises in shooting comfort and accuracy, maximizing the versatility of the Marlin 336 platform. Failure to address this critical aspect can lead to a suboptimal setup, hindering performance and negating the advantages of a see-through mount. Careful selection and, if necessary, professional consultation are recommended to ensure proper height and seamless integration with the rifle and scope.

2. Eye Relief

Eye relief, the distance between the scope’s eyepiece and the shooter’s eye, is a critical factor when selecting and installing a see-through scope mount on a Marlin 336. Insufficient eye relief can lead to “scope bite,” a painful recoil injury caused by the scope striking the shooter’s brow. This is particularly relevant with lever-action rifles like the Marlin 336, which can exhibit noticeable recoil, especially with more powerful loads. A see-through mount, by its nature, often positions the scope higher and slightly further rearward than a standard mount, potentially exacerbating scope bite if eye relief isn’t carefully considered. For example, a scope with short eye relief combined with an improperly positioned see-through mount creates a high risk of injury, particularly during rapid firing or when using heavy recoil ammunition.

Choosing a scope with adequate eye relief is paramount. Longer eye relief provides a larger margin of error, reducing the risk of scope bite and improving shooting comfort. This becomes increasingly important when shooting from unconventional positions or in dynamic situations, where consistent cheek weld and head position may be difficult to maintain. Furthermore, the height of the see-through mount influences the required eye relief. A higher mount may necessitate a scope with even greater eye relief to maintain a safe and comfortable shooting experience. For instance, a scope with 3 inches of eye relief might be sufficient with a standard mount, but a see-through mount raising the scope another inch could require a scope with 4 or more inches of eye relief to avoid scope bite.

Proper eye relief is essential for safe and effective use of a see-through scope mount on a Marlin 336. Ignoring this critical factor can lead to injury and significantly diminish the shooting experience. Careful consideration of scope selection, mount height, and individual shooting style ensures optimal eye relief, maximizing both comfort and safety. Ultimately, achieving proper eye relief contributes significantly to the overall effectiveness and enjoyment of the Marlin 336 platform, especially when utilizing a see-through mounting system.

3. Compatibility

Compatibility is paramount when selecting a see-through scope mount for a Marlin 336 lever-action rifle. An incompatible mount can lead to frustrating installation issues, compromised accuracy, and potential damage to the firearm or scope. Several factors influence compatibility, and careful consideration of each ensures a functional and reliable setup.

  • Receiver Configuration:

    Marlin 336 rifles have been produced with several different receiver configurations over the years, impacting mount compatibility. Early models often feature a tapped receiver for direct mounting, while later models may have a Weaver or Picatinny rail already installed. Aftermarket mounts are designed for specific receiver types. Attempting to install a mount designed for a tapped receiver on a Picatinny-railed receiver, for example, will result in an improper fit and potential damage. Accurate identification of the receiver configuration is crucial for selecting a compatible mount. Resources such as manufacturer websites and firearm forums can assist in this process.

  • Ring Type and Size:

    The scope rings, which attach the scope to the mount, must be compatible with both the mount and the scope. See-through mounts typically utilize Weaver or Picatinny rails, and the rings must match the rail type. Furthermore, the ring diameter must correspond to the scope tube diameter. Using incorrect ring sizes, such as 30mm rings on a 1-inch scope tube, will result in an insecure fit and potential damage to the scope. Mismatched ring types or sizes can lead to slippage, impacting accuracy and potentially damaging the scope or mount. Careful measurement and selection of appropriate rings are essential.

  • Mount Material and Construction:

    The material and construction of the mount influence its durability and stability. Aluminum mounts are lightweight but may not withstand heavy recoil as effectively as steel mounts. However, steel mounts can add significant weight to the rifle. The manufacturing process also impacts quality. Precision machining and robust construction ensure proper alignment and secure mounting. A poorly constructed mount can deform under stress, impacting accuracy and potentially causing damage. Selecting a mount made from high-quality materials and manufactured to exacting standards ensures long-term reliability and consistent performance.

  • Clearance with Other Components:

    The see-through mount must not interfere with other rifle components, such as the loading gate, ejection port, or hammer. Insufficient clearance can impede operation and cause malfunctions. For example, a bulky mount might obstruct the loading gate, preventing proper ammunition feeding. Similarly, inadequate clearance with the ejection port can disrupt spent cartridge ejection, leading to jams. Evaluating potential interference before installation is essential. Examining the mount’s dimensions and comparing them to the rifle’s configuration can help identify potential compatibility issues.

Understanding and addressing these compatibility factors are essential for successfully installing and utilizing a see-through scope mount on a Marlin 336. Overlooking these aspects can lead to a range of issues, from minor inconveniences to significant performance problems and potential safety hazards. Thorough research, careful measurement, and attention to detail ensure a compatible setup that enhances the versatility and functionality of the Marlin 336 platform.

Question 1: What advantages does a see-through scope mount offer over a traditional scope mount on a Marlin 336?

The primary advantage is the ability to utilize both a riflescope for longer ranges and iron sights for close-range shots without detaching or adjusting any components. This adaptability proves particularly beneficial in hunting scenarios where target distances can change rapidly.

Question 2: Are see-through scope mounts suitable for all shooting applications with a Marlin 336?

While beneficial in many situations, they might not be ideal for all applications. Benchrest shooting or long-range target shooting, where consistent use of magnified optics is prioritized, might benefit more from a lower, more stable traditional scope mount.

Question 3: Do all see-through mounts fit all Marlin 336 rifles?

No. Variations exist in Marlin 336 receiver configurations over the years. Confirming receiver compatibility with the chosen mount is crucial before purchase and installation.

Question 4: Can any scope be used with a see-through mount on a Marlin 336?

While many scopes are compatible, considerations include eye relief, objective lens diameter, and overall scope length. Insufficient eye relief can lead to injury, while large objective lenses might interfere with the iron sights. Compatibility with ring sizes is also important.

Question 5: Is professional installation of a see-through scope mount recommended?

While experienced individuals can install these mounts themselves, professional gunsmithing ensures proper alignment and avoids potential damage to the firearm or scope. Professional installation is particularly recommended for those unfamiliar with firearm modifications.

Question 6: Will installing a see-through scope mount void the warranty on a Marlin 336?

It depends on the warranty terms and the nature of the installation. Some manufacturers may consider modifications a breach of warranty. Consulting the manufacturer or warranty documentation before modification is advisable.

Optimizing Marlin 336 See-Through Scope Mount Setups

Effective use of a see-through scope mount on a Marlin 336 requires attention to detail and a thorough understanding of the interplay between various components. These tips provide practical guidance for maximizing the benefits of this versatile setup.

Tip 1: Prioritize Mount Height: Mount height is paramount. Adequate height ensures clear visibility of iron sights while maintaining a comfortable cheek weld. Measure and consider individual preferences before selecting a mount.

Tip 2: Select Appropriate Eye Relief: Prevent scope bite by choosing a scope with ample eye relief, particularly with heavier recoiling loads. Longer eye relief enhances comfort and safety, especially during rapid firing sequences.

Tip 3: Verify Compatibility Meticulously: Confirm compatibility between the mount, receiver configuration, scope rings, and scope tube diameter. Incompatibilities can lead to instability, damage, and compromised accuracy.

Tip 4: Opt for Quality Materials and Construction: Durable materials and robust construction ensure long-term reliability, especially under stress. High-quality mounts maintain zero and resist deformation, contributing to consistent accuracy.

Tip 5: Check for Component Clearance: Ensure the mount does not interfere with the lever, loading gate, ejection port, or hammer. Obstructions can lead to malfunctions and operational issues, hindering performance and potentially causing damage.

Tip 6: Consider Scope Objective Lens Size: Large objective lenses, while offering increased light gathering capabilities, can interfere with the sight picture through a see-through mount. Balance optical performance with practical considerations for simultaneous sight usage.

Tip 7: Seek Professional Guidance When Necessary: If uncertainties arise regarding installation or compatibility, consulting a qualified gunsmith is advisable. Professional expertise can prevent costly mistakes and ensure optimal setup.

Adhering to these guidelines enhances the effectiveness and safety of a see-through scope mount setup on a Marlin 336. Careful consideration of each element contributes to a customized configuration optimized for individual needs and preferences.
